The Feast of the Nativity of Mary
Happy Birthday to the Blessed Virgin Mary, Conceived without Sin! The Dawn of Salvation is upon us for the Mother of God is born! Today, Our Lady is born of St. Anne and this feast marks 9 months since the feast of Mary's Immaculate Conception on December 8th. We can celebrate by throwing a birthday party with blue and white decorations and cake ! Today's liturgical color is white for Mary's purity or gold for her glory.
